Top 8 Quotes from Schitt’s Creek

This article is written by a student writer from the Her Campus at Toronto MU chapter.

Seven years ago, we were introduced to the Rose family. They gave us some of the most iconic moments with their crazy family dynamic and witty personalities. Now, seven years later, I’m going to give you my favourite quotes from the show.

“Ew, David!”

Said by the bougie fashionista herself, this Alexis Rose quote is arguably the most famous from the show. Alexis never fails to deliver her valley-girl-inspired self, while also making sure she fulfils the duty of a sister: To annoy her older brother David. As my favourite quote from the series, I say this line multiple times a day and have a sticker of it on my laptop.

“You just fold it in!”

Moira and David have quite an interesting mother-son bond. When trying to pass down her mother’s recipe for enchiladas to David, the two get into a fight about folding cheese. Moira won’t admit that she doesn’t know what’s going on and yells, “you just fold it in!”

“Tweet us on Facebook.”

Johnny Rose perfectly encapsulates a dad with this quote. Johnny is one of my favourite characters from the series because of how out of it he is. I appreciate the effort here, but who’s gonna tell him that he’s mixing two different social media platforms?

“Eat glass!”

If David and Alexis don’t sum up the perfect sibling relationship, then I don’t know what does. When in a fight, David tells his sister to “eat glass,” which seems harsh, but they’re siblings and at the end of the series. You know how much they love each other.

“You know what David? You get murdered first for once.”

I loved getting snippets of Alexis’s old and adventurous life. In the first episode of the series, David wants Alexis to switch beds with him since her’s is further away from the door. This way, if an attacker breaks in, Alexis gets murdered first. Name a better sibling duo.

“Where is the bébé’s chamber?”

Moira’s accent is everything. After rewatching the series multiple times, I still can’t place where it’s from. She uses a mix of British and old English in her daily life, making all her lines stand out a bit more.

“This isn’t say yes to the dress princess. Orange is the new orange.”

Good ol’ Ronnie, she’s the definition of sarcasm. She has a mellow personality and doesn’t talk much, but when she does, everything that comes out of her mouth is gold. She’s one person who can put the fashion diva Alexis in her place.

“I’m incapable of faking sincerity.”

Stevie, David’s best friend, is the type of person who speaks her mind, most likely because she has no filter. Always there for her best friend, she pushes David to open his own store, Rose Apothecary. She’s blunt and can’t fake her emotions. We all need a Stevie.
